Jim Carrey's net worth refers to the total value of his assets, including his earnings from his acting career, investments, and other sources of income, minus his liabilities such as taxes and debts.

As of 2023, Jim Carrey's net worth is estimated to be around $180 million. This wealth has been accumulated over several decades of acting in successful films such as "Ace Ventura: Pet Detective," "The Mask," and "Bruce Almighty." In addition to his acting income, Carrey has also earned revenue from endorsements, investments, and other business ventures.
